Penguin Card has released more details, the core takeaways are: In partnership with KAST, KYC is not directly available in mainland China, but passport + Hong Kong address is acceptable; tested successfully. The card has three tiers: Standard, Black, and Gold (Figure 1). Referring to the original KAST card tiers (Figure 2), the Standard card should be free, while the Black card, in addition to invitation-based ranking, may have annual fees of $1000 and $5000 respectively. Cashback: The Standard card nominally offers 6% cashback, consisting of 2% KAST points and 4% $MOVE tokens. - KAST points can be converted into token rewards during Q2/Q3 TGE this year (there's a catch: a one-time conversion halves the reward). - The 4% $MOVE tokens are time-limited; there's no expiration date yet, but they are available for the first $2000 of spending each month, and then disappear.
